Costello syndrome
is a "RASopathy" that is characterized by growth retardation, dysmorphic facial appearance, hypertrophic cardiomyopathy and tumor predisposition. >80% of patients with
Costello syndrome
harbor a heterozygous germline G12S mutation in HRAS. Altered metabolic regulation has been suspected because patients with
Costello syndrome
exhibit hypoketotic hypoglycemia and increased resting energy expenditure, and their growth is severely retarded. To examine the mechanisms of energy reprogramming by HRAS activation in vivo, we generated knock-in mice expressing a heterozygous Hras G12S mutation (Hras
G12S/+
mice) as a mouse model of
Costello syndrome
. On a high-fat diet, Hras
G12S/+
mice developed a lean phenotype with microvesicular hepatic steatosis, resulting in early death compared with wild-type mice. Under
starvation
conditions, hypoketosis and elevated blood levels of long-chain fatty acylcarnitines were observed, suggesting impaired mitochondrial fatty acid oxidation. Our findings suggest that the oncogenic Hras mutation modulates energy homeostasis in vivo.
